Ordinals
beta
Address 36PQJBm8ebFqsb3XJ1rZLFq4ZEVePN3HvX
sat balance
509000
runes balances
outputs
d69166bbc99b0ba58499f0fb1b8285aa3be3dba02f099308a72af3baae9ff772:0